|
klee
|
This is the complete list of members for klee::Interpreter, including all inherited members.
| create(llvm::LLVMContext &ctx, const InterpreterOptions &_interpreterOpts, InterpreterHandler *ih) | klee::Interpreter | static |
| getConstraintLog(const ExecutionState &state, std::string &res, LogType logFormat=STP)=0 | klee::Interpreter | pure virtual |
| getCoveredLines(const ExecutionState &state, std::map< const std::string *, std::set< unsigned > > &res)=0 | klee::Interpreter | pure virtual |
| getPathStreamID(const ExecutionState &state)=0 | klee::Interpreter | pure virtual |
| getSymbolicPathStreamID(const ExecutionState &state)=0 | klee::Interpreter | pure virtual |
| getSymbolicSolution(const ExecutionState &state, std::vector< std::pair< std::string, std::vector< unsigned char > > > &res)=0 | klee::Interpreter | pure virtual |
| Interpreter(const InterpreterOptions &_interpreterOpts) | klee::Interpreter | inlineprotected |
| interpreterOpts | klee::Interpreter | protected |
| KQUERY enum value | klee::Interpreter | |
| LogType enum name | klee::Interpreter | |
| prepareForEarlyExit()=0 | klee::Interpreter | pure virtual |
| runFunctionAsMain(llvm::Function *f, int argc, char **argv, char **envp)=0 | klee::Interpreter | pure virtual |
| setHaltExecution(bool value)=0 | klee::Interpreter | pure virtual |
| setInhibitForking(bool value)=0 | klee::Interpreter | pure virtual |
| setModule(std::vector< std::unique_ptr< llvm::Module > > &modules, const ModuleOptions &opts)=0 | klee::Interpreter | pure virtual |
| setPathWriter(TreeStreamWriter *tsw)=0 | klee::Interpreter | pure virtual |
| setReplayKTest(const struct KTest *out)=0 | klee::Interpreter | pure virtual |
| setReplayPath(const std::vector< bool > *path)=0 | klee::Interpreter | pure virtual |
| setSymbolicPathWriter(TreeStreamWriter *tsw)=0 | klee::Interpreter | pure virtual |
| SMTLIB2 enum value | klee::Interpreter | |
| STP enum value | klee::Interpreter | |
| useSeeds(const std::vector< struct KTest * > *seeds)=0 | klee::Interpreter | pure virtual |
| ~Interpreter() | klee::Interpreter | inlinevirtual |